Dรฉtails du cours

โ€ข Introduction to Shape Memory Alloys (SMAs): Understanding the basics, properties, and types of SMAs.
โ€ข SMA Manufacturing Processes: Exploring various methods for producing SMA components.
โ€ข Fundamentals of Shape Memory Effect (SME): Delving into the science behind SME and its applications.
โ€ข Superelasticity in SMAs: Examining the unique superelastic properties of certain alloys.
โ€ข Designing with SMAs: Learning how to incorporate SMAs into innovative engineering designs.
โ€ข SMA Applications: Investigating the use of SMAs in various industries, such as aerospace, automotive, and medical.
โ€ข SMA Actuators: Focusing on the use of SMAs as actuators for precise motion control.
โ€ข SMA Sensors: Exploring the potential of SMAs as temperature and strain sensors.
โ€ข SMA Challenges and Future Developments: Discussing current limitations and future research directions for SMA technology.

Here are some engaging descriptions for the roles in the 3D pie chart: 1. **Medical Devices Engineer**: Leveraging shape memory alloys, these professionals create innovative medical solutions like actuators, stents, and valves, significantly improving patient care. (45%) 2. **Aerospace Engineer**: These experts use shape memory alloys to design adaptive structures, deployable systems, and morphing wings, making aircraft more efficient and environmentally friendly. (25%) 3. **Automotive Engineer**: Working with shape memory alloys, automotive engineers develop advanced safety features like shape memory alloy-based seat belts, improving road safety. (15%) 4. **Consumer Goods Designer**: Designers integrate shape memory alloys into daily-use items like eyewear, kitchen tools, and textiles, creating intelligent and user-friendly products. (10%) 5. **Electronic Devices Engineer**: Engineers utilize shape memory alloys to build flexible electronic devices and miniaturized components, enabling greater innovation in the tech industry.
